PureBasic Versus language C

Sujets variés concernant le développement en PureBasic
Avatar de l’utilisateur
Polux
Messages : 440
Inscription : mer. 21/janv./2004 11:17
Localisation : france
Contact :

Message par Polux »

On est bien d'accord... je ne dis pas de bien de VB pour des applis complexes ou des jeux.. c'est sur.. mais c'est un bon petit outil pour petites applis.. Moi je sais que je m'en sers encore au boulot ( bien que j'utilise plus .net maintenant ) mais j'écris mes grosses applis en Delphi ou en c++.. quand aux jeux, Pure sans hésiter ( je pense même m'en servir bientôt pour les applis ) :wink: !
Avatar de l’utilisateur
ZapMan
Messages : 460
Inscription : ven. 13/févr./2004 23:14
Localisation : France
Contact :

Message par ZapMan »

Je vois qu'on dérive vers un débat
"PurePasic Versus VB"
ce qui est aussi trés intéressant.

Je n'ai pas pratiqué VB, d'aprés ce que je comprends, il est assez bien équipé pour la gestion des bases de données alors que PureBasic est encore un peu léger sur le sujet.

Je suggère donc que Fred inscrive ce point à l'ordre des développements futurs (pour la version 5, peut-être) tout en ayant noté que :
- ce n'est probablement (à son point de vue) de première urgence
- c'est un gros chantier. Comme Fred l'a fait remarqué dans l'une de ses réponses du forum, s'il commence à mettre les doigts dedans, les utilisateurs vont lui en demander de plus en plus. En clair, il faut faire ça à fond ou pas du tout.
Tout obstacle est un point d'appui potentiel.

Bibliothèques PureBasic et autres codes à télécharger :https://www.editions-humanis.com/downlo ... ads_FR.htm
KarLKoX
Messages : 1191
Inscription : jeu. 26/févr./2004 15:36
Localisation : France
Contact :

Message par KarLKoX »

Oui je pense qu'il y a un grand chantier mais je suis sur qu'avec le support des activex/objets ole (que j'aime pas plus que ca), ca accélérera grandement le support des bases de données, c'est comme ca que font la plupart des langages actuelles (Delphi, VB et même C/C++ via VC++).
Pour la partie linux, un support ODBC suffira, le pilote Linux fera le reste :)
En tout cas, ca sera surement une grande valeur ajoutée si PureBasic arrive à se démarquer dans ce domaine face à VB pour pénétrer le marcher professionnel :D
"Qui baise trop bouffe un poil." P. Desproges
Dräc
Messages : 526
Inscription : dim. 29/août/2004 0:45

Message par Dräc »

Maintenant que je connais bien PB, j’ai eu la même réflexion que celle de Zapman et voilà que je trouve cette discussion sur le sujet.
Delors que l’on prend la peine de comparer le C à Pure, c’est assez troublant :
les instructions, les tableaux, les structures, les fonctions, les pointeurs (dont les pointeurs de fonction), nombreux sont les parallèles !

La dénomination « Basic » cache à tort le fait que tout comme le C, PureBasic est un langage de haut niveau qui inclut des fonctionnalités bas niveau !
En ce sens, Pure mérite largement sa dénomination de langage…
popstatic
Messages : 83
Inscription : lun. 20/sept./2004 18:21
Localisation : derriere toi fais gaffe!

Message par popstatic »

Hum, un convertisseur C->PB.....

pourquoi pas!

pour des raisons de rapidité, d'economie mémoire et de facilité de conception je proposerai du perl ou du php.

Ne sautez pas en l'air! je pense que ça n'est pas si bête que ça car ces deux langages interprétés ont le tres grand avantage d'être pourvus de fonctions de parsing très éfficaces et très optimisés, notament pour les regex.

autre avantage, pouvoir aisément mettre ce script en ligne et faire de la conversion via un site web.

pour les "tristes" on peut tout aussi le faire en C, aussi avec les expressions régulieres (j'y tiens!!) avec regex.h mais j'ignore si cette lib (dépendante de la libC) existe sous windows.

bref, il est vrai que comme la grande majorité des structures (opérateurs, boucles etc...) qui existent en C ont leur equivalent en PB c'est parfaitement faisable et même assez rapide à faire (par rapide j'entend pas trop long si je me fait bien comprendre).

Bonne idée.
Asus bien? asus tres bien!
Répondre